In order to avoid the type of surgery entailed with either a Brazilian butt lift or buttock implants, some patients are electing to have Sculptra injected into their hips for volumizing purposes. Please be aware that this will take several treatments and a multiple vials of Sculptra to achieve meaningful results. Best wishes.
For patients with a limited source of donor fat we have been using Sculptra as an alternative. The most common location is for a buttocks lift. Many of the Hollywood stars discovered this and have been doing it for the past couple years. It takes a large number of vials, usually 20 to 40 vials injected over 2 to 3 sessions. The upside is that there is no downtime associated with the procedure and it offers an alternative to that person who has no other options other than an implant. This procedure was featured on The Doctors and reported to begin at $20,000. You may be able to find it for substantially less away from the coasts.
